The concept of electric vehicles (EVs) is not as modern as many might think. In fact, the history of EVs dates back to the early 19th century. Around 1832, Robert Anderson of Scotland is credited with developing the first crude electric carriage. However, it was not until the late 1800s and early 1900s that electric vehicles began to materialize as a practical form of transportation. Innovators like Thomas Edison and others explored electric vehicle technology, believing it could provide a cleaner, quieter alternative to the gasoline engines of their time.

Early Designs and Notable Examples

The design of early electric vehicles was quite basic by today’s standards. They often resembled carriages and were powered by lead-acid batteries. Some of the notable examples from this era include:

  • The Flocken Elektrowagen of 1888: Often regarded as the first real electric car, it was developed in Germany by Andreas Flocken.
  • Detroit Electric: Produced by the Anderson Electric Car Company from 1907 to 1939, these vehicles were popular for their reliability and ease of use. Detroit Electrics could run between 60 to 80 miles on a single charge, a respectable range even today.

Despite their initial popularity, especially among urban dwellers and women who appreciated the ease of starting and operating an electric car compared to a gasoline vehicle, electric vehicles began to decline in popularity.

Reasons Behind the Historical Unpopularity of EVs

Several key factors contributed to the decline of electric vehicles in the early 20th century:

  • Limited Range and Speed: Compared to their gasoline counterparts, early electric vehicles had limited range and lower top speeds, which made them less attractive for longer trips.
  • Improvement in Internal Combustion Engines: Advancements in internal combustion engine technology, including the electric starter, made gasoline cars more convenient and efficient.
  • Infrastructure Development: The expansion of road infrastructure encouraged long-distance travel, favoring gasoline cars that could refuel easily.
  • Mass Production: The introduction of mass production techniques by Henry Ford made gasoline cars significantly cheaper and more accessible to the general public.

Societal Response and Modern Resurgence

In the late 20th and early 21st centuries, electric vehicles began to make a comeback, driven by growing environmental concerns and advancements in technology. Society’s response has been increasingly positive, with many consumers and governments now supporting the transition to electric mobility. This change is fueled by:

  • Environmental Awareness: Increased awareness of climate change and urban pollution has made the zero-emission nature of electric vehicles more appealing.
  • Technological Advancements: Improvements in battery technology, particularly lithium-ion batteries, have significantly increased the range and decreased the charging time of EVs.
  • Government Incentives: Many countries offer tax incentives, subsidies, and benefits like free parking and exemption from toll charges to encourage EV adoption.

Challenges in Implementing Electric Vehicle Technology

Despite the growing popularity and apparent benefits of electric vehicles, several challenges remain:

  • Charging Infrastructure: Developing a widespread and convenient charging infrastructure is crucial to facilitate the transition to electric mobility. This remains a significant barrier in many regions.
  • Battery Cost and Performance: While the cost of EV batteries has decreased, it remains a substantial part of the vehicle’s price. Additionally, battery life and performance in extreme climates are concerns that still need addressing.
  • Market Adaptation: Transitioning from a market dominated by internal combustion engines to one powered by electricity involves vast changes, not only in terms of vehicle technology but also in the broader energy infrastructure and economic policies.
